The Best Time to Travel: Weather in Hong Kong

The Best Time to TravelSpring (March to mid-May) Temperatures and humidity rise gradually in spring. Evenings can be cool but lightweight jackets suffice. The average temperature ranges from 18oC-27oC (64oF-80oF), humidity about 82 per cent.


Summer
(late May to mid-September) Hot and humid with temperatures ranges from 26oC-33oC (78oF-91oF) and humidity near 86 per cent. Short sleeves and cotton clothes work best, with a lightweight sweater for indoors as restaurants tend to set air-conditioning on high. An umbrella or hat works well to ward off the sun.


Autumn
(late September to early December) Clear and sunny days are the norm in autumn. Short sleeves and light jackets are most suitable at this time of year. The average temperature ranges from 18oC-28oC (64oF-82oF), humidity about 72 per cent.


Winter
(mid-December to February) Winters are mild with low humidity at 72 per cent. Though the temperature ranges from 14oC-20oC (57oF-68oF), the mercury can drop to 10oC (50oF). Occasional chills make woollens and overcoats necessary.
